WebMar 23, 2024 · There is more incomplete combustion occurring with IPA, hence the smoky orange flame and smell of soot. Ethanol combusts more completely, leading to a blue (soot-free) flame and no smell. In response … Web2.2.1 Burning of ethanol. When you burn – or combust – ethanol (C 2 H 5 OH) in air (which contains oxygen, O 2), the final products obtained are carbon dioxide gas (CO 2) and water (H 2 O). Looking at this reaction is …

This is because the hydrogen of the OH group is better at … bond burguerWebThe combustion energy for ethanol is –1367 kJ mol –1 corresponding to the equation: C 2 H 5 OH (l) + 3O 2 (g) → 2CO 2 (g) + 3H 2 O (l) The demonstration could be used in a variety of contexts: Learning about … goal bpsAn alcohol burner is a sturdy, lightweight, reusable tool for burning alcohol. The alcohol is poured into the center reservoir and then lit. The vapors escape from a ring of small holes to create a nice even fire. The flame ignites the vapors, not the liquid fuel. Two ounces of alcohol will burn for 10-15 minutes depending … See more The alcohol stove pictured is used for camping, backpacking, and military.
